كود الآلة

اختيار وشراء الوكلاء

كود الآلة، والذي يشار إليه أيضًا باسم لغة الآلة، هو اللغة الأساسية لأجهزة الكمبيوتر، ويتم فهمها ومعالجتها مباشرة بواسطة وحدة المعالجة المركزية للكمبيوتر (CPU). ويتكون من سلسلة من الأرقام الثنائية (البتات) أو الرموز السداسية العشرية، التي تمثل التعليمات التي يمكن تنفيذها بواسطة وحدة المعالجة المركزية. يقوم هذا الكود بترجمة لغات البرمجة عالية المستوى إلى نموذج يمكن تنفيذه مباشرة بواسطة الكمبيوتر.

تاريخ أصل كود الآلة وأول ذكر له

يمكن إرجاع جذور كود الآلة إلى الأيام الأولى للحوسبة. نشأ هذا المفهوم مع اختراع أول كمبيوتر قابل للبرمجة، وهو المحرك التحليلي، الذي صممه تشارلز باباج في ثلاثينيات القرن التاسع عشر. على الرغم من أنه لم يتحقق بالكامل، إلا أن تصميم باباج وضع الأساس لآلات الحوسبة المستقبلية.

تم العثور على أول تطبيق ناجح لرمز الآلة في كمبيوتر ENIAC (المتكامل العددي الإلكتروني والكمبيوتر)، الذي اكتمل في عام 1945. وكان بمثابة بداية عصر الحوسبة الإلكترونية وتطوير لغات التجميع، مما سمح للمبرمجين بكتابة التعليمات البرمجية بسهولة أكبر. .

معلومات تفصيلية حول رمز الجهاز: توسيع رمز الجهاز الموضوع

يعد رمز الجهاز جزءًا لا يتجزأ من أنظمة الكمبيوتر ويستخدم لتوجيه وحدة المعالجة المركزية مباشرة. فيما يلي نظرة أكثر تفصيلاً على وظائفه ومكوناته:

  1. تعليمات: يحتوي رمز الجهاز على تعليمات محددة تخبر وحدة المعالجة المركزية بما يجب القيام به، مثل العمليات الحسابية أو نقل البيانات.
  2. السجلات: يستخدم سجلات مختلفة داخل وحدة المعالجة المركزية للتخزين المؤقت ومعالجة البيانات.
  3. أوضاع المعالجة: طرق مختلفة لتحديد موقع البيانات، مما يسمح بالوصول المرن إلى الذاكرة.
  4. دورة التنفيذ: سلسلة من الخطوات التي تمر بها وحدة المعالجة المركزية لتفسير وتنفيذ كل تعليمات كود الجهاز.

الهيكل الداخلي لرمز الآلة: كيف يعمل رمز الآلة

يمكن فهم البنية الداخلية لرمز الآلة من حيث تنسيقها الثنائي وتنفيذها:

  1. التمثيل الثنائي: يتم تمثيل رمز الآلة باستخدام أرقام ثنائية، تتكون من 0 و1، بمحاذاة نمط محدد.
  2. مجموعة التعليمات: مجموعة محددة من التعليمات التي يمكن لوحدة المعالجة المركزية فهمها وتنفيذها.
  3. كود التشغيل والمعاملات: يتم تقسيم التعليمات إلى كود التشغيل، الذي يحدد العملية التي سيتم تنفيذها، والمعاملات، التي توفر البيانات أو موقع البيانات.
  4. تنفيذ: تقوم وحدة المعالجة المركزية بجلب التعليمات وفك تشفيرها وتنفيذها واحدة تلو الأخرى في دورة تعرف باسم دورة تنفيذ التعليمات.

تحليل الميزات الرئيسية لرمز الآلة

تشمل الميزات الرئيسية لرمز الآلة ما يلي:

  • كفاءة: ينفذ التعليمات مباشرة، مما يسمح بالتنفيذ بسرعة عالية.
  • الاعتماد على الآلة: خاصة ببنية وحدة المعالجة المركزية (CPU) معينة، مما يعني أن التعليمات البرمجية المكتوبة لوحدة المعالجة المركزية (CPU) قد لا تعمل على أخرى.
  • لغة منخفضة المستوى: صعوبة في الكتابة والفهم، مقارنة باللغات ذات المستوى الأعلى.
  • المرونة: يوفر تحكمًا كاملاً في الأجهزة، مما يسمح بتحسين الأداء.

أنواع كود الآلة: نظرة عامة

توجد أنواع مختلفة من رموز الجهاز بناءً على بنية وحدة المعالجة المركزية. فيما يلي جدول لتوضيح بعض البنى الشائعة:

بنيان وصف
x86 بنية مستخدمة على نطاق واسع في أجهزة الكمبيوتر الشخصية
ذراع شائع في الأجهزة المحمولة بسبب كفاءته في استخدام الطاقة
MIPS تستخدم في تطبيقات مختلفة من الأنظمة المدمجة إلى أجهزة الكمبيوتر العملاقة
باور بي سي مصممة لأجهزة الكمبيوتر الشخصية والحوسبة عالية الأداء
سبارك تستخدم بشكل رئيسي في الخوادم ومحطات العمل المتطورة

طرق استخدام كود الآلة ومشاكلها وحلولها المتعلقة بالاستخدام

يُستخدم رمز الآلة بشكل أساسي في برمجة الأنظمة والتطبيقات ذات الأداء الحيوي. تتضمن بعض المشكلات والحلول المتعلقة برمز الجهاز ما يلي:

  • مشكلة: التعقيد والطبيعة المعرضة للخطأ
    حل: استخدام اللغات والمترجمات عالية المستوى لكتابة التعليمات البرمجية.
  • مشكلة: الاعتماد على المنصة
    حل: استخدام المترجمين المتقاطعين أو الأجهزة الافتراضية لضمان إمكانية النقل.
  • مشكلة: انعدام الأمن في التلاعب المباشر
    حل: تنفيذ آليات السلامة والاستفادة من ممارسات الترميز الآمنة.

الخصائص الرئيسية ومقارنات أخرى مع مصطلحات مماثلة

مقارنات بين كود الآلة ولغة التجميع واللغات عالية المستوى:

شرط تعتمد على الآلة مستوى التجريد سرعة تعقيد
كود الآلة نعم قليل عالي عالي
لغة التجميع جزئيا واسطة واسطة معتدل
لغات عالية المستوى لا عالي قليل قليل

وجهات نظر وتقنيات المستقبل المتعلقة برمز الآلة

يستمر كود الآلة في لعب دور حاسم في مختلف المجالات. قد تشمل التطورات المستقبلية ما يلي:

  • الاحصاء الكمية: الاستفادة من الظواهر الكمومية لإجراء حسابات معقدة.
  • التحسين القائم على الذكاء الاصطناعي: خوارزميات التعلم الآلي لتحسين كود الآلة تلقائيًا.
  • التوحيد عبر الأنظمة الأساسية: تطوير معايير كود الآلة الموحدة لضمان إمكانية النقل بشكل أفضل.

كيف يمكن استخدام الخوادم الوكيلة أو ربطها برمز الجهاز

تعمل الخوادم الوكيلة، مثل تلك التي يوفرها OneProxy، كوسيط بين طلبات العميل والخوادم. على الرغم من أنها لا ترتبط بشكل مباشر برمز الآلة، إلا أنه يمكن أن يكون لها تقاطع بالطرق التالية:

  • تحسين الأداء: يمكن استخدام رمز الجهاز المخصص في الخوادم الوكيلة لتحسين الأداء.
  • التحسينات الأمنية: دمج ميزات الأمان على مستوى رمز الجهاز في الوكلاء لتوفير حماية قوية.
  • التفاعل مع البروتوكولات منخفضة المستوى: إدارة بروتوكولات الشبكة منخفضة المستوى من خلال رمز الجهاز لتحسين كفاءة الوكيل.

روابط ذات علاقة

  1. مجموعة تعليمات إنتل x86
  2. الدليل المرجعي لهندسة ARM
  3. الهندسة المعمارية MIPS
  4. الحوسبة الكمومية: منظور IBM

توفر هذه الروابط معلومات أكثر تفصيلاً حول الجوانب المختلفة لرمز الآلة، مما يعزز فهم القارئ لمفهوم الحوسبة الأساسي هذا.

الأسئلة المتداولة حول رمز الآلة: رؤية شاملة

رمز الآلة هو اللغة الأساسية لأجهزة الكمبيوتر، ويتكون من أرقام ثنائية أو رموز سداسية عشرية، والتي يمكن معالجتها مباشرة بواسطة وحدة المعالجة المركزية للكمبيوتر. يقوم بترجمة لغات البرمجة عالية المستوى إلى نموذج يمكن تنفيذه مباشرة بواسطة الكمبيوتر. إنه أمر حيوي لأنه يتيح الاتصال المباشر مع الأجهزة، مما يؤدي إلى التنفيذ الفعال للتعليمات.

نشأ رمز الآلة مع اختراع تشارلز باباج للمحرك التحليلي في ثلاثينيات القرن التاسع عشر. وقد تحقق هذا المفهوم مع الانتهاء من الكمبيوتر ENIAC في عام 1945، إيذانا ببداية الحوسبة الإلكترونية.

تشمل الميزات الرئيسية لرمز الآلة كفاءتها في التنفيذ، والاعتماد على الآلة (خاص ببنية معينة لوحدة المعالجة المركزية)، وطبيعتها ذات المستوى المنخفض (التي يصعب كتابتها وفهمها)، والمرونة، مما يوفر تحكمًا كاملاً في الأجهزة.

نعم، يختلف رمز الجهاز بناءً على بنية وحدة المعالجة المركزية. تتضمن بعض البنى الشائعة x86، وARM، وMIPS، وPowerPC، وSPARC، وكل منها مصمم لأنواع مختلفة من أجهزة الكمبيوتر والتطبيقات.

تتضمن بعض المشكلات المتعلقة برمز الآلة تعقيدها وطبيعتها المعرضة للأخطاء واعتمادها على النظام الأساسي ومخاطرها الأمنية. تتضمن الحلول استخدام لغات عالية المستوى، ومترجمين متقاطعين، وأجهزة افتراضية، وممارسات تشفير آمنة.

من المحتمل أن يلعب كود الآلة دورًا في التقنيات المستقبلية مثل الحوسبة الكمومية، والتحسين المعتمد على الذكاء الاصطناعي، والتوحيد عبر الأنظمة الأساسية. قد تستفيد هذه التطورات من كود الآلة لإجراء العمليات الحسابية المعقدة والتحسينات التلقائية وإمكانية النقل بشكل أفضل.

يمكن أن تتقاطع الخوادم الوكيلة مثل تلك التي يوفرها OneProxy مع رمز الجهاز من خلال تحسين الأداء وتحسينات الأمان والتفاعل مع بروتوكولات الشبكة ذات المستوى المنخفض. يمكن استخدام رمز الجهاز المخصص في الخوادم الوكيلة لتحسين وظائفها.

يمكنك العثور على معلومات أكثر تفصيلاً حول رمز الجهاز من خلال موارد مثل مجموعة تعليمات إنتل x86, الدليل المرجعي لهندسة ARM, الهندسة المعمارية MIPS، و الحوسبة الكمومية: منظور IBM.

وكلاء مركز البيانات
الوكلاء المشتركون

عدد كبير من الخوادم الوكيلة الموثوقة والسريعة.

يبدأ من$0.06 لكل IP
وكلاء الدورية
وكلاء الدورية

عدد غير محدود من الوكلاء المتناوبين مع نموذج الدفع لكل طلب.

يبدأ من$0.0001 لكل طلب
الوكلاء الخاصون
وكلاء UDP

وكلاء مع دعم UDP.

يبدأ من$0.4 لكل IP
الوكلاء الخاصون
الوكلاء الخاصون

وكلاء مخصصين للاستخدام الفردي.

يبدأ من$5 لكل IP
وكلاء غير محدود
وكلاء غير محدود

خوادم بروكسي ذات حركة مرور غير محدودة.

يبدأ من$0.06 لكل IP
هل أنت مستعد لاستخدام خوادمنا الوكيلة الآن؟
من $0.06 لكل IP